DEDE織夢(mèng)后臺登入提示驗證碼錯誤的方式
優(yōu)采云 發(fā)布時(shí)間: 2020-04-13 11:09
說(shuō)一下見(jiàn)到這些情況的幾種緣由:
?、?網(wǎng)站空間滿(mǎn)了(**首先考慮**)
?、诟目臻g后新的空間里pho.ini里gd庫配置問(wèn)題
?、踕ede版本程序升級操作不正確導致驗證碼提示不正確
?、軐?zhuān)對5.7版本轉移data目錄造成的(此種請查看:如何將dede織夢(mèng)data目錄正確遷移及造成的
問(wèn)題解決方式)
?、莩绦騼?data/session目錄權限設置問(wèn)題
?、耷宄秊g覽器的cookies,重啟瀏覽器;
?、呔W(wǎng)速不行,換個(gè)時(shí)間,等網(wǎng)速快了再試!
?、嗑W(wǎng)站程序出錯,重新上傳安裝。
好了,引起dede織夢(mèng)后臺登錄驗證碼錯誤或則不顯示的誘因找到了,那么如今我們來(lái)總結一下解
決辦法。
1、查看空間的容量是否早已滿(mǎn)了,把一些不要的資源刪除,重新試試看能夠登入網(wǎng)站后臺。
2、如果是5.7版本的轉移data目錄引發(fā)的。
請改一下/include/vdimgck.php這個(gè)文件 這個(gè)文件里也調用了DATA里的文件也可以改路徑,把
帶有這個(gè) /../data 改成你如今的路徑。
3、查閱資料后獲知,session沒(méi)有去除,去data/session目錄下,將除index.html以外文件全
部刪掉就可以了。
4、如果還是不行織夢(mèng)系統總是提示驗證碼錯誤,看session是否有寫(xiě)入權限,如果沒(méi)有的話(huà)織夢(mèng)系統總是提示驗證碼錯誤,給"internet來(lái)賓帳戶(hù)"添加寫(xiě)入
權限,Linux的話(huà),目錄權限設置為"777"。
5、設置服務(wù)器的php.ini:打開(kāi)php.ini 文件找到;session.save_path = "/tmp" 改寫(xiě)成
session.cookie_path = /把extension=php_gd2.dll;將他后面的分號;去掉。
6、檢查你的空間是不是滿(mǎn)了,測試的方式是你可以隨意上傳FTP空間里一個(gè)文件,會(huì )有提示,你
可以聯(lián)系空間服務(wù)商。
7、直接除去驗證碼:打開(kāi) login.php 找到:
if($validate=='' || $validate != $svali)
替換為:
if( false )
然后,在模板dede/templets/login.htm里除去以下驗證碼的具體HTML代碼:
<li><span>驗證碼:</span>
<input name="validate" type="text" id="vdcode"
style='width:50px;text-transform:uppercase;' class="text" />
<img id="vdimgck" src="../include/vdimgck.php" alt="看不清?點(diǎn)擊更換"
align="absmiddle" style="cursor:pointer" />
</li>
或者是:在[驗證碼安全設置]里,說(shuō)修改后的保存實(shí)際上是更改了data\safe
\inc_safe_config.php 這個(gè)文件,這是個(gè)配置文件。
比如:$safe_gdopen = '1,2,3,5,6'; 這個(gè)就是系統什么地方開(kāi)啟驗證碼。與[驗證碼安全設置
]界面是*敏*感*詞*的關(guān)系。
所以,如果當我們管理后臺想關(guān)掉驗證碼(如果驗證碼未能正確輸入,不支持GB庫)的時(shí)侯,只需
要打開(kāi)data\safe\inc_safe_config.php 將$safe_gdopen = '1,2,3,5,6'; 中的6刪掉即可。
不必去進(jìn)行冗長(cháng)的設置。
如圖
8、是更改include文件夾的vdimgck.php文件更改以下段落,
//Session保存路徑
$sessSavePath = dirname(__FILE__)."/../data/sessions/";
修改為//$sessSavePath = dirname(__FILE__)."/../data/sessions/";
修改后,時(shí)好使時(shí)不好使,改回去也是這樣的情況。如果把DEDE后臺路徑更改默認的DEDE文件夾
,就不會(huì )出現驗證碼錯誤的情況。
最后假如以上方式均不適用的話(huà),那么你就重新安裝下對應版本的程序,然后將您的css及圖片
文件,模板文件,upload文件夾轉移過(guò)來(lái)。最后還原數據庫。